Our vision

We invite couples to courageously follow Jesus in their marriage, understanding that life is not meant to be lived in isolation. Together, we can thrive, growing stronger in our faith and relationship through the support of our community groups with other couples, or by walking alongside mentors—or even becoming mentors!
 

We’re here to help you cultivate a healthy and strong marriage and family. Our desire is to equip marriages with a solid foundation so they can flourish and transform neighbourhoods, communities, and future generations. Whether you’re preparing for marriage, blending a family, enriching your marriage, struggling through a crisis, or trying to figure out how to raise Godly kids, we have something for every season.

Our strategic focus

Pre-marriage

Build a community of married and engaged couples through date nights, workshops, courses, and events.

Couples growth

Establish couple groups to support one another no matter what stage of married life they are in. 

marriage mentoring

Create a network of marriage mentors to support newlywed couples aligning with our Trinity Church calling.

Mentorship

Couples mentorship at Trinity Church is more than just guidance—it’s about building a community where healthy, thriving marriages are the norm. By participating in this program, whether as a mentor or mentee, you contribute to a culture of strong, faith-filled relationships that extend beyond individual couples to impact the entire church and local community. Together, we create a network of support that strengthens our collective faith and witness.
